Commit e71a23e6 authored by 郭铭瑶's avatar 郭铭瑶 🤘

Merge branch 'master' of http://git.omniview.pro/yaominguo/east-nanjing-new into dist

parents 2e762f79 740feb19
NODE_ENV = production
\ No newline at end of file
NODE_ENV = test
\ No newline at end of file
This diff is collapsed.
This source diff could not be displayed because it is too large. You can view the blob instead.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This diff is collapsed.
This source diff could not be displayed because it is too large. You can view the blob instead.
This diff is collapsed.
This diff is collapsed.
.brief-container[data-v-074669a4]{display:flex;align-items:center;white-space:nowrap}.brief-container .count[data-v-074669a4]{font-size:.11rem}.brief-container .count.yellow[data-v-074669a4]{font-size:.13rem;color:#ffd400}.brief-container>div[data-v-074669a4]{display:flex;align-items:center;flex:1;margin-left:.05rem}.brief-container>div>img[data-v-074669a4]{margin-right:.05rem}.brief-container>div>div[data-v-074669a4]{font-weight:700}.brief-container>div>div p[data-v-074669a4]{color:#ccc}.brief-container>div>div.center[data-v-074669a4]{text-align:center}.circle-wrapper[data-v-fb0eadd2]{width:100%;height:100%;box-sizing:border-box;display:flex;align-items:center;justify-content:center;flex-direction:column;position:relative}.circle-wrapper>p[data-v-fb0eadd2]{margin-top:.1rem;font-size:.12rem;font-weight:700}
\ No newline at end of file
import{d as e,p as A,a,r as t,o as l,b as k,F as r,f as s,l as o,e as f,t as y,w as n,g as i,h as v,c,j as u}from"./index.30006334.js";var p=e({name:"Brief",props:{list:{type:Array,required:!0},color:{type:String,default:null},size:{type:String,default:"0.22rem"}}});const z=n("data-v-074669a4");A("data-v-074669a4");const d={class:"brief-container"},g={key:1},w={class:"count-group"},B=i(" / ");a();const h=z(((e,A,a,n,i,v)=>{const c=t("m-count");return l(),k("div",d,[(l(!0),k(r,null,s(e.list,(A=>(l(),k("div",{key:A.name},[A.icon?(l(),k("img",{key:0,src:A.icon,style:`width:${e.size};height:${e.size}`},null,12,["src"])):o("",!0),Array.isArray(A.value)?(l(),k("div",g,[f("div",w,[f(c,{class:"count yellow",value:A.value[0]},null,8,["value"]),B,f(c,{class:"count",value:A.value[1]},null,8,["value"])]),f("p",null,y(A.name),1)])):(l(),k("div",{key:2,class:{center:!A.icon}},[f(c,{class:"count yellow",style:{color:e.color},value:A.value},null,8,["style","value"]),f("p",null,y(A.name),1)],2))])))),128))])}));p.render=h,p.__scopeId="data-v-074669a4";var m=e({name:"Circle",props:{type:{type:String,default:"circle"},color:{type:[String,Array],default:["#0094FF","#1DF9FF"]},value:{type:Number,default:0},name:{type:String,default:""},showInfo:{type:Boolean,default:!0},rate:{type:Number,default:1.8},strokeWidth:{type:Number,default:6},gapDegree:{type:Number,default:0}},setup(e){const A=v(null),a=c((()=>Array.isArray(e.color)?{"0%":e.color[0],"100%":e.color[1]}:e.color)),t=c((()=>A.value?A.value.clientWidth/(e.rate||1.8):0));return{circleWrapperRef:A,strokeColor:a,width:t}}});const D=n("data-v-fb0eadd2");A("data-v-fb0eadd2");const S={ref:"circleWrapperRef",class:"circle-wrapper"};a();const U=D(((e,A,a,r,s,o)=>{const n=t("a-progress");return l(),k("div",S,[f(n,{width:e.width,"stroke-color":e.strokeColor,percent:e.value,type:e.type,"show-info":e.showInfo,"stroke-width":e.strokeWidth,"gap-degree":e.gapDegree},null,8,["width","stroke-color","percent","type","show-info","stroke-width","gap-degree"]),u(e.$slots,"default",{},(()=>[f("p",null,y(e.name),1)]))],512)}));m.render=U,m.__scopeId="data-v-fb0eadd2";var E="",N="",C="",M="";export{p as _,m as a,C as b,M as c,E as d,N as e};
This source diff could not be displayed because it is too large. You can view the blob instead.
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<link rel="icon" href="./favicon.ico" />
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>南京东路街道</title>
<script type="module" crossorigin src="./assets/index.30006334.js"></script>
<link rel="modulepreload" href="./assets/vendor.3a6a5816.js">
<link rel="stylesheet" href="./assets/index.ef1ef3e3.css">
</head>
<body>
<div id="app"></div>
<script src="./SMap.min.js"></script>
<script src="./Plugins.min.js"></script>
<script src="./hls.js"></script>
</body>
</html>
\ No newline at end of file
......@@ -6,8 +6,8 @@
"scripts": {
"dev": "vite",
"start": "npm run dev",
"clean": "rimraf ./dist",
"build": "npm run clean && vuedx-typecheck . && vite build"
"build": "vuedx-typecheck . && vite build --mode test",
"build:pro": "vuedx-typecheck . && vite build --mode production"
},
"dependencies": {
"animate.css": "^4.1.1",
......
This source diff could not be displayed because it is too large. You can view the blob instead.
let BASE_URL = ''
let SOURCE_URL = ''
switch (process.env.NODE_ENV) {
case 'production':
BASE_URL = '/nd-api' // 设置代理
// 政务网生产环境,设置了代理api
BASE_URL = '/nd-api'
SOURCE_URL = 'http://10.81.71.243:23456/nd-file/'
break
case 'test':
// 普通打包(测试用)
BASE_URL = 'http://nandong-dev.omniview.pro/api'
SOURCE_URL = 'http://zhongbang.omniview.pro/'
break
default:
// 开发环境
BASE_URL = '/api'
SOURCE_URL = 'http://zhongbang.omniview.pro/'
}
export default {
BASE_URL,
SOURCE_URL: 'http://10.81.71.243:23456/nd-file/', // 设置代理
SOURCE_URL,
GET_BUILDING: '/service-basicdatasync-ddd/building', // 门牌幢列表
GET_INDUSTRY_AUTHORITY: '/service-basicdatasync-ddd/indCous', // 业委会列表
GET_COMMITTEE: '/service-basicdatasync-ddd/residentsCommittees', // 居委会列表
......
// declare const SMap: any
// declare const Plugins: any
// export interface ConfigProp {
// el: string
// options: MapOptionsProp
// sources: string[]
// }
// export interface MapOptionsProp {
// viewMode?: string
// center?: number[]
// zooms?: number[]
// zoom?: number
// pitch?: number
// mapStyle?: string
// showBuildingBlock?: boolean
// }
// class Map {
// map: any
// config: ConfigProp
// constructor(config: ConfigProp) {
// this.config = config
// }
// injectSource(): Promise<unknown[]> {
// const promises = this.config.sources.map(
// (source: string, index: number) => {
// return new Promise((resolve) => {
// if (document.getElementById(`_source${index}`)) {
// resolve(true)
// return
// }
// const sourceJs = document.createElement('script')
// sourceJs.type = 'text/javascript'
// sourceJs.src = source
// sourceJs.setAttribute('id', `_source${index}`)
// document.head.appendChild(sourceJs)
// window.onload = () => resolve(true)
// })
// }
// )
// return Promise.all(promises)
// }
// }
// export class S_Map extends Map {
// constructor(config: ConfigProp) {
// super(config)
// this.injectSource().then(this.initMap)
// }
// initMap(): void {
// this.map = new SMap.Map(this.config.el, this.config.options)
// }
// onLoaded(cb: (arg: unknown) => void): void {
// this.map.on(SMap.MapEvent.maploaded, cb)
// }
// onZoomChange(cb: (arg: unknown) => void): void {
// this.map.on(SMap.MapEvent.zoomchanged, cb)
// }
// onCenterChange(cb: (arg: unknown) => void): void {
// this.map.on(SMap.MapEvent.centerchanged, cb)
// }
// onBlur(cb: (arg: unknown) => void): void {
// this.map.on(SMap.MapEvent.blur, cb)
// }
// onFocus(cb: (arg: unknown) => void): void {
// this.map.on(SMap.MapEvent.focus, cb)
// }
// onDrag(cb: (arg: unknown) => void): void {
// this.map.on(SMap.MapEvent.drag, cb)
// }
// onClick(cb: (arg: unknown, point: unknown) => void): void {
// this.map.on(SMap.MapEvent.click, (view: any, eventParamter: any) => {
// view.hitTest(eventParamter).then((res: any) => {
// if (res.results && res.results.length > 0) {
// cb(
// res.results[0] && res.results[0].graphic.attributes,
// eventParamter.mapPoint
// )
// }
// })
// })
// }
// }
......@@ -37,42 +37,42 @@ export default function useSwitchMap(map: any) {
store.commit('SET_MAP_TYPE', '2D')
}
)
const boundary = ref<any>(null)
let boundary = null
// 根据条件显示小区点和添加边界
function setPointsAndBoundary(type: string) {
boundary.value && map.value.remove(boundary.value)
boundary && boundary.remove()
const show = store.state.showCommunityPoints
switch (type) {
case 'work1':
show && showPoints({ gridId: store.state.workArea1.id })
boundary.value = map.value.addBoundary({
type: 'njdljd_boundary',
name: '第一工作站',
boundary = map.value.addBoundary({
type: 'jwh_boundary',
name: '第一',
color: 'rgba(0,0,0,0)',
})
map.value.focus(...store.state.workArea1.center, 8)
break
case 'work2':
show && showPoints({ gridId: store.state.workArea2.id })
boundary.value = map.value.addBoundary({
type: 'njdljd_boundary',
name: '第二工作站',
boundary = map.value.addBoundary({
type: 'jwh_boundary',
name: '第二',
color: 'rgba(0,0,0,0)',
})
map.value.focus(...store.state.workArea2.center, 8)
break
case 'work3':
show && showPoints({ gridId: store.state.workArea3.id })
boundary.value = map.value.addBoundary({
type: 'njdljd_boundary',
name: '第三工作站',
boundary = map.value.addBoundary({
type: 'jwh_boundary',
name: '第三',
color: 'rgba(0,0,0,0)',
})
map.value.focus(...store.state.workArea3.center, 8)
break
case 'street':
show && showPoints()
boundary.value = map.value.addBoundary({
boundary = map.value.addBoundary({
name: '南京东路街道',
color: 'rgba(0,0,0,0)',
})
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ment